​Mike Reeves - Track coach

Picture
Although no longer on the committee, Mike Reeves is still at the track on most Thursday evenings coaching club members.
Mike is a founder member of PWR being one of the twelve to join in on the first night.  He first competed in athletics in 1975 for Bexley AC and after 25 years service to the club was made a life member in 2000. His PBs include a 1:12:56 Half Marathon and a 2:58:06 Marathon.  In 1984 Mike was diagnosed with Ankylosing Spondylitis and was told he may never run again.  Mike achieved his first coaching badge in 1986. Mike was proud to be selected as a masseur for the 2012 London Olympics and worked in the Olympic Stadium with the athletics and the basketball arena with the Paralympians.
